Abstract

The present invention provides a compound having the structure: wherein R 1 , R 2 , R 3 , R 4 , and R 5 are each independently H, halogen, CF 3 or C 1 -C 4 alkyl, wherein two or more of R 1 , R 2 , R 3 , R 4 , or R 5 are other than H; R 6 is H, OH, or halogen; and B is a substituted or unsubstituted heterobicycle, wherein when R 1 is CF 3 , R 2 is H, R 3 is F, R 4 is H, and R 5 is H, or R 1 is H, R 2 is CF 3 , R 3 is H, R 4 is CF 3 , and R 5 is H, or R 1 is Cl, R 2 is H, R 3 is H, R 4 is F, and R 5 is H, or R 1 is CF 3 , R 2 is H, R 3 is F, R 4 is H, and R 5 is H, or R 1 is CF 3 , R 2 is F, R 3 is H, R 4 is H, and R 5 is H, or R 1 is Cl, R 2 is F, R 3 is H, R 4 is H, and R 5 is H, then B is other than or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of.
